Output e9424103ea23ccdea48f12e3a36af5141721b8e36cb12e73793b1c0d5b19de69:21

value
6678000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 946e1c4a063e33a35c0881584665f928361184c1 OP_EQUAL
address
3FDqqYf8aq1mQJMLzrU8WXkAaebAKM19Xp
transaction
e9424103ea23ccdea48f12e3a36af5141721b8e36cb12e73793b1c0d5b19de69
spent
true